Overview

Cobblestone Stairs are blocks in the Utility Blocks category of Minecraft, obtained through crafting them and Stonecutter. A single inventory slot holds a full stack of 64 Cobblestone Stairs.

On the hardness scale Cobblestone Stairs sit at 2. A pickaxe makes Cobblestone Stairs quick, and even the cheapest one still drops them. Blast resistance sits at 6.

Notes

A stonecutter produces 1 stairs per cobblestone instead of 4 per 6.
